At least 7 dead in Bangladesh road mishap

Thirty others were injured when a passenger bus and a truck collided head-on in northeastern Bangladesh.

A passenger bus and a truck collided head-on in northeastern Bangladesh on Monday, killing at least seven people and leaving about 30 others injured, a TV station reported.

Five people died instantly, and two others died from wounds on the way to a hospital after the accident in Habiganj district, private television station, ATNBangla reported.

Most of the casualties were on board the bus, which was travelling from capital, Dhaka, to Habiganj, 120 kms northeast of the capital, the report said.
